Exploring Sites Not on GamStop
GamStop is a self-exclusion scheme designed to help UK players take a break from gambling by blocking access to licensed British operators. However, many bettors find themselves seeking sites not on GamStop for various reasons, including stricter control over their gambling choices or access to different markets and betting options. These platforms operate under international licenses from jurisdictions such as Curacao, Malta, or Gibraltar, allowing them to accept UK players whilst remaining outside the GamStop framework.
The main distinction between GamStop-registered and non-registered sites lies in their licensing authority and regulatory oversight. Whilst UK Gambling Commission-licensed sites must participate in GamStop, offshore operators answer to different regulatory bodies with their own standards and player protection measures. Understanding this fundamental difference helps punters choose wisely about where they choose to place their wagers and what degree of regulatory safeguard they can expect from these other operators.
It’s crucial to recognise that operating outside GamStop doesn’t necessarily indicate illegitimacy or poor quality. Many well-regarded global betting sites maintain high standards of security, fair play, and customer service despite not being registered with the UK’s self-exclusion scheme. The key lies in diligently investigating each operator’s background, checking their licensing status, and confirming they have robust player protection measures before committing any funds to these alternative betting platforms.

Global Regulatory Standards
Reputable international betting operators work within licences from prominent regulatory organizations such as the Malta Gaming Authority, Curacao eGaming, or the Gibraltar Gambling Commission. These jurisdictions implement strict compliance requirements, including regular audits, responsible gaming practices, and transparent financial practices that ensure protection of player interests.
The licensing information should be prominently featured on the site’s homepage, generally in the footer section. Reputable operators display license numbers that can be verified directly through the official regulator portal, guaranteeing transparency and accountability in their operations.

How to Confirm Authenticity of Non-GamStop Sites
The first step in validating any sportsbook is checking its licence information. Established bookmakers present their regulatory credentials prominently in the bottom of the site, generally provided by bodies including the MGA, Curacao eGaming, or the UK Gambling Commission for sites still accepting UK players. You can verify these licensing credentials directly on the regulator’s site to verify legitimacy and identify any sanctions or warnings against the operator.
Security measures provide crucial indicators of a platform’s trustworthiness. Look for encrypted SSL certificates, shown by the padlock symbol in your browser’s address bar and URLs beginning with “https”. Legitimate betting sites maintain comprehensive security measures, including two-factor authentication features, secure payment gateways, and transparent privacy policies that comply with GDPR regulations. Additionally, check whether the site accepts established payment methods like Visa, Mastercard, or trusted e-wallet services.
Independent reviews and user testimonials offer valuable insights into an operator’s reputation. Investigate the platform on established review platforms, gambling forums, and online networks to recognize common themes in player experiences. Give careful consideration to withdrawal processing times, support team efficiency, and how the operator handles disputes. Established platforms typically have extensive track records and keep favorable scores across multiple review platforms, whilst new platforms need closer examination.
Responsible gambling features showcase a site’s commitment to player welfare. Even though these operators operate outside GamStop, legitimate operators still provide spending caps, time restrictions, awareness prompts, and account closure tools. Verify whether the site shows links to organisations like GamCare, BeGambleAware, or Gamblers Anonymous. The availability of transparent policies, reasonable promotional terms, and accessible customer support through various platforms further indicates a trustworthy operation that emphasises player protection alongside entertainment.

Curacao Licensed Providers
The Curacao eGaming Authority serves as one of the longest-standing licensing jurisdictions for international betting platforms. Operators holding Curacao licences must show financial stability, establish responsible gaming measures, and ensure secure payment processing systems. This Caribbean nation has licensed online betting operators since 1996, establishing a well-developed regulatory framework that reconciles accessibility with player protection standards.
Curacao-regulated platforms typically provide varied wagering markets, competitive odds, and lucrative bonus offers. The jurisdiction’s streamlined licensing process allows operators to establish operations efficiently whilst maintaining critical safeguards. Players should verify the licence number displayed on the operator’s website and check it with Curacao’s official registry to confirm authenticity before registering an account.
Malta and Gibraltar Options
The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) enforces exceptionally rigorous standards, making it one of Europe’s most respected licensing bodies. MGA-licensed operators pass through comprehensive background checks, financial audits, and operational evaluations. Gibraltar Regulatory Authority likewise maintains rigorous standards, ensuring operators maintain corporate governance, player fund segregation, and transparent business practices throughout their operations.
Both jurisdictions require operators to implement robust responsible gambling tools, maintain adequate capital reserves, and submit to regular compliance reviews. These European licensing authorities provide players with additional confidence through established complaint resolution mechanisms and strict enforcement procedures. Platforms licensed by Malta or Gibraltar typically display their credentials prominently, allowing players to verify legitimacy through official regulatory databases before committing funds.
Essential Elements to Consider Before You Join
Before signing up with any offshore betting platform, thoroughly evaluate your betting patterns and verify you possess adequate self-control mechanisms in place. While these platforms operate legally under global regulatory bodies, they sit outside the UK’s responsible gambling framework, meaning you lack access to GamStop protections or UKGC complaint procedures if problems occur.
Review establishing deposit limits and time restrictions before you begin playing, as many reputable international operators provide their own responsible gambling tools. Research the platform’s withdrawal policies, payment processing times, and support responsiveness to avoid possible issues. Keep in mind that currency conversion fees may be charged when making payments through international methods.
Always keep detailed records of your gambling activity, including deposits, withdrawals, and any communications with the operator. Ensure you understand the tax consequences of offshore gambling winnings in the UK, and don’t risk more than you can comfortably lose. If you find yourself struggling with gambling control, get expert assistance through services like GamCare or BeGambleAware immediately.
